Calories in MACARONI & CHEESE LOAF

Serving Size: 1 Serving (32.0g)
Amount Per Serving
  • Calories 89.9
  • Total Fat 7.0 g
  • Saturated Fat 3.0 g
  • Cholesterol 15.0 mg
  • Sodium 310.1 mg
  • Potassium 0.0 mg
  • Total Carbohydrate 2.0 g
  • Dietary Fiber 0.0 g
  • Sugars 0.0 g
  • Protein 4.0 g

Ingredients

BEEF AND PORK, WATER, PASTEURIZED CHEDDAR CHEESE (CHEDDAR CHEESE (CULTURED MILK, SALT, ENZYMES), CREAM, SODIUM PHOSPHATE, SALT, SORBIC ACID (PRESERVATIVE), APO-CAROTENAL AND BETA CAROTENE (COLOR)), MACARONI (WHEAT SEMOLINA, NIACIN, FOLIC ACID, FERROUS SULPHATE (IRON), RIBOFLAVIN, THIAMINE MONONITRATE), NONFAT DRY MILK, CORN SYRUP, SALT, SWEET RED PEPPERS (BELL PEPPERS, WATER, CITRIC ACID), DEXTROSE, SODIUM CITRATE, SPICES, SODIUM DIACETATE, ONION, SODIUM ERYTHORBATE, SPICE EXTRACTIVES, GARLIC, SODIUM NITRITE.

Calorie Analysis

The food MACARONI & CHEESE LOAF, based on the serving size listed above, would account for 4.5% of your daily allotted calories based on a 2,000 calorie diet. The majority of the calories for this food comes from fat. Fat makes up 70.1% of the calories.
